中文字幕精品亚洲无线码二区,国产黄a三级三级三级看三级,亚洲七七久久桃花影院,丰满少妇被猛烈进入,国产小视频在线观看网站

24、服務器CPU持續(xu)飆高的(de)排查思路與(yu)方(fang)案

背景:

服務部署在(zai)Docker容(rong)器中,Prometheus監(jian)控中心(xin)配置相關告警(jing)規則,某(mou)臺(tai)機器因CPU使用率較高而(er)觸(chu)發告警(jing)

相關機器下排查思路與方案:

1、獲取CPU高對應的服務:

# Docker 容器的(de)實時資源(yuan)使用情況
sudo docker stats

2、進入指定容器:

sudo docker exec -it <容器ID> /bin/bash

3、查看所有正在運行的 Java 進程(列出進程 ID 和啟動的類名或 JAR 文件名)

jps

4、根據進程 ID查看占用CPU高的線程

# top -Hp 1
top -Hp <進程ID>

5、將指定 PID 轉為 16進制

# printf "%x\n" 60 =》 輸出3c
printf "%x\n" <PID>

6、通過jstack分析對應線程堆棧信息,根據堆棧信息排查問題

# 分析線程堆棧信息(-A 20:表示輸出 20 行)
# jstack 1 | grep '3c' -A 20
jstack <進程ID> | grep '<16進制PID>' -A 20

 

posted on 2025-04-23 11:30  愛文(Iven)  閱讀(51)  評論(0)    收藏  舉報

導航